sivaji j.g wrote:
Start with joomla then move on to drupal, moodle etc.
Uh-huh. From my perspective, that's a very bad place to start. Sure
they're popular, but I've seen programmers permanently scarred by the
'php mindset'. They can't grok good app design if it hits them on their
head. Perhaps SICP is overkill, but it's not such a bad place to start.
Sohail, I would recommend you aim higher - go learn Ruby or Python.
Start with self-respecting web-frameworks like Rails or Django. They
won't be as easy to get started with as PHP, but it will be worth your
effort. Oh yes, if you want to get anywhere in modern web development at
all, take Mano's advice and don't forget to master Javascript :).
